FMS | Pain | Psychopharmacology The Psychopharmacology Advisory Board brings together experts in psychiatry, psychopharmacology, and the pathophysiology of mood disorders to work with the FMS Advisory Board on a multidisciplinary approach to FMS treatment and diagnosis. The Board’s primary responsibility is assisting us in selecting and evaluating the potential effectiveness of drug candidates and designing clinical trials for these compounds.
Charles Nemeroff, M.D., Ph.D. – Chairman Dr. Nemeroff has been the Reunette W. Harris Professor and Chairman of the Department of Psychiatry and Behavioral Sciences at the Emory University School of Medicine in Atlanta, Georgia since 1991. He serves on the Mental Health Advisory Council of the National Institute of Mental Health and the Biomedical Research Council for NASA. Dr. Nemeroff is the President of the American College of Psychiatrists and the past President of the American College of Neuropsychopharmacology. He serves as the Editor-in-Chief of the Psychopharmacology Bulletin, Associate Editor of Biological Psychiatry and is the Co-Editor-in-Chief of both Critical Reviews in Neurobiology and Depression and Anxiety. Dr. Nemeroff serves on the scientific advisory board of numerous pharmaceutical companies including Acadia Pharmaceuticals, Astra Pharmaceuticals, Forest Laboratories, Janssen, Organon, Glaxo SmithKline Beecham and Wyeth-Ayerst. Dr. Nemeroff has received numerous awards for his research including the Bowis Award from the American College of Psychiatrists and the Menninger Prize from the American College of Physicians.
